GZA GeoEnvironmental awarded Dunkirk marina design contract
Trusted by teams at
Description
Dunkirk Common Council approved a professional services contract with GZA GeoEnvironmental of New York, not to exceed $198,277, to design and engineer new docks for the DRI-funded marina expansion project running through 2029. The firm will provide full design and construction support services with MWBE participation.
